Flooring: Structural Integrity and Trade-Quality Tongue & Groove
A firm favourite in our flooring range is the OSB TG4 board, tongue-and-grooved on all sides for durability, moisture resistance, and a secure fit – ideal for subfloors, roof decking, sheathing, or timber-frame floors.
This TG4 flooring is especially suited to:
- Residential and commercial subfloors – delivering a stable base to build on.
- Roofing decks and structural sheathing – where moisture resistance and strength matter.
- Outbuildings, workshops or site offices – robust enough for trade or commercial use.
For loft-boarding, we offer tongue-and-groove boards for easy installation and stable surfaces.
This makes our flooring range relevant not only for primary floor installations but also for renovations, loft conversions, or structural works where subfloors need to perform under load, resist moisture, and maintain long-term stability.
Cladding: Professional Finishes for Internal Walls, Ceilings or Light Commercial Use
Our cladding range includes high-quality Shiplap, Loglap, and V-Board, giving trade professionals versatile solutions for both interior and exterior projects. Manufactured from quality timber and precision-milled for consistency, these boards deliver clean lines, reliable performance and fast installation on site.
Shiplap cladding offers a tongue and groove profile for effective weather resistance, making it ideal for sheds, garden rooms, garages, outbuildings and external walls, as well as internal feature spaces. Treated options provide added protection against moisture and decay, extending service life in exposed environments.
Loglap cladding delivers a more pronounced, rounded profile, perfect for projects requiring a stronger visual impact such as cabins, annexes, workshops and garden buildings. Like our shiplap range, treated variants are available for enhanced durability outdoors.
V-Board cladding provides a smooth, planed finish with a classic V-groove profile, ready for painting or staining. It’s ideally suited for walls, ceilings, feature panels, hallways, retail interiors and light commercial fit-outs, delivering a clean, professional aesthetic with minimal finishing work.
